I remember years ago North Carolina had an exemption for all farm purchases such as tractors from state taxes. That changed and what started out @ 1% has now increased to the normal state sales tax rate for all agriculture purchases. So, the FEL that I just purchased for $2850 had an additional 8% tax added to it. That's the cost of doing business these days.
You can obtain an agricultural sales tax exemption for ag. purchases in NC if you have the required ag. income. You have to obtain an Exemption ID if you qualify. The required application form is E-595EA.Sales and Use Tax Forms and Certificates
